Jangseong-gun Operates Monkeypox Prevention Task Force
[Jangseong=Asia Economy Honam Reporting Headquarters, Reporter Jo Hangyu] Jangseong-gun, Jeollanam-do, is operating a quarantine task force to block community transmission and respond swiftly following the occurrence of the country's first confirmed case of monkeypox.
According to the county on the 5th, the Jangseong-gun Public Health Center has formed a quarantine task force composed of doctors, nurses, and others to respond promptly in case of confirmed cases, as the infectious disease crisis level was recently raised from 'interest' to 'caution.'
The quarantine task force will carry out roles such as patient epidemiological investigation, medical support and contact management, and support for supplies and preventive activities.
Monkeypox is an acute febrile rash disease caused by a viral infection, with an incubation period of 5 to 21 days, during which symptoms such as vesicular rash, fever, and muscle pain occur.
To prevent infection, it is advised to refrain from visiting countries where monkeypox has occurred, and above all, it is important to follow personal hygiene rules such as wearing masks and washing hands.
A health center official said, "If you have suspicious symptoms, please report promptly to the health center or the Korea Disease Control and Prevention Agency call center," adding, "Especially medical institutions are requested to report suspected monkeypox patients to the local health center within 24 hours."
